Types of Cans
The most common types of cans are the standard tin can, the pop-top can, and the stay-on-tab can. The standard tin can requires a can opener to access the contents, while the pop-top and stay-on-tab cans have a built-in opening mechanism. The pop-top can features a removable tab that, when pulled, opens the can, while the stay-on-tab can has a tab that stays attached to the can after opening.

What are the different types of can openers available for opening canned drinks?
There are several types of can openers available in the market, each with its unique features and benefits. Manual can openers are the most common type and are widely used due to their simplicity and affordability. They work by piercing the top of the can and then rotating the cutting wheel to remove the lid. Automatic can openers, on the other hand, are more convenient and easy to use, as they can open cans with the touch of a button. They are also faster and more efficient than manual can openers.
In addition to manual and automatic can openers, there are also other types of can openers available, such as keychain can openers, pocket can openers, and multi-tool can openers. Keychain can openers are small and portable, making them ideal for outdoor activities or travel. Pocket can openers are also compact and can be easily carried in a pocket or purse. Multi-tool can openers, as the name suggests, come with additional features such as bottle openers, knives, and screwdrivers, making them a versatile and handy tool to have in the kitchen or on the go.

How do I clean and maintain my can opener?
To clean and maintain your can opener, start by wiping it down with a damp cloth to remove any food or drink residue. You can also use a mild soap and water to clean the opener, but be sure to rinse it thoroughly to avoid any soap residue. For more stubborn stains or residue, you can use a mixture of equal parts water and white vinegar to clean the opener. It’s also a good idea to dry the opener thoroughly after cleaning to prevent rust or corrosion.
Regular maintenance is also important to keep your can opener in good working condition. You should check the opener regularly for any signs of wear or damage, such as rust or corrosion, and replace it if necessary. You should also lubricate the moving parts of the opener regularly to keep it running smoothly. Additionally, you can store the opener in a dry place to prevent rust or corrosion, and consider cleaning it after each use to prevent the buildup of residue.
